This invention relates to athletic supporters and more particularly to an athletic supporter having an access opening therein and a slide fastener secured thereto for closing the access opening.
It is among the objects of the invention to provide an athletic supporter which may be of substantially conventional construction including a belt, a crotch piece depending from the belt and straps securing the end of the crotch piece remote from the belt to the belt at locations spaced from the crotch piece, but which has an access opening in the form of a slit extending longitudinally of the crotch piece and a slide fastener secured to the crotch piece along the opposite sides of the slit to close the slit; which has a piece of webbing secured to the inner side of the crotch piece in covering relationship to the slit therein and to the slide fastener to protect the skin of a person wearing the supporter from the slide fastener when the slide fastener is opened or closed; and which is simple and durable in construction, and convenient and comfortable to Wear.
Other objects and advantages will become apparent from a consideration of the following description and the appended claims in conjunction with the accompanying drawing wherein:
Figure 1 is a front elevational view of an athletic supporter illustrative of the invention;
Figure 2 is a fragmentary cross sectional view on the line 2--2 of Figure l; and
Figure 3 is a fragmentary perspective view showing the inner side of the crotch piece of the supporter and a fragmentary portion of the associated belt.
With continued reference to the drawing, the athletic supporter is formed of elastic, fabric material, such materials usually including a mixture of cotton and rubber threads woven together, and includes a waist encircling belt Ill, a cupped crotch piece H secured at one end to the belt H], as indicated at !2, symmetrically of the mid-length location of the front portion of the belt, and straps l3 and I4 secured to the crotch piece II at the end of the latter remote from the belt and secured at their ends to the belt at locations substantially equally spaced from the opposite sides of the end of the crotch piece secured to the belt and near the opposite sides of the belt.
As athletic supporters of the character indicated are well known to the art and are readily available commercially, a more detailed illustration and description of the supporter itself is 2 considered unnecessary for the purposes of the present disclosure.
In accordance with the present invention, the crotch piece II of the supporter is provided with an access opening in the form of a slit l5 extending longitudinally of the crotch piece and medially of the width thereof from a location adjacent the edge of the belt II] from which the crotch piece extends to a location near, but spaced from the end of the crotch piece to which the straps l3 and [4 are connected. A slide fastener I6 is secured to the crotch piece along the opposite sides of the slit is by suitable means, such as stitching, and includes the usual interlocking element ll secured to tapes which extend one along each side of the slit l5 and are secured by stitching to the crotch piece, a slide l8 movable along the slide fastener to engage and disengage the element I1, and a pull tab l9 pivotally secured to the slide is for moving the slide longitudinally of the slide fastener to open and close the slide fastener. The slide fastener 16 may be of a form well known to the art and readily available commercially and may be secured to the crotch piece II of the athletic supporter in the usual manner.
A flap or cover 20 in the form of a piece of fabric or tape of elongated, rectangular shape is disposed against the inner side of the crotch piece H of the supporter and extends longitudinally of the slide fastener l6 somewhat beyond the respectively opposite ends of the slide fastener. The flap also extends outwardly of the respectively opposite sides of the slide fastener and is secured to the crotch piece It across both ends and along one longitudinal edge of the flap by suitable means, such as the stitching 2|.
When the slide fastener I6 is opened, the slit l5 and the open side of the flap 20 provide an access opening through the crotch piece II of the supporter, and the flap 2!] protects the wearer of the supporter from the slide fastener when the latter is closed.
